日韩免费,日 韩 a v 在 线 看,北京Av无码,国模蔻蔻私拍一区

華為手機的APP開發(fā)語言及設(shè)置指南

一、華為的鴻蒙系統(tǒng):編程語言與開發(fā)方式解析

首先讓我們探究一下華為鴻蒙系統(tǒng)的開發(fā)語言。根據(jù)公開的方舟編譯器資料,鴻蒙系統(tǒng)是以C和C++語言為基礎(chǔ)進行編寫的。與方舟編譯器的理念一致,鴻蒙系統(tǒng)采用直接編寫機器語言的方式,取消了中間層,實現(xiàn)了更高效的編譯和執(zhí)行。這意味著應(yīng)用程序被直接編譯為二進制機器碼,無需中間轉(zhuǎn)換,執(zhí)行速度更快。這種方式對內(nèi)存空間的需求更高,并需要更多的靜態(tài)方案。值得一提的是,鴻蒙系統(tǒng)的微內(nèi)核設(shè)計,可按需擴展并實現(xiàn)更廣泛的系統(tǒng)安全,特別適用于物聯(lián)網(wǎng)場景,具備低時延特性,甚至達到毫秒級乃至亞毫秒級的響應(yīng)速度。

二、不同手機系統(tǒng)下的應(yīng)用開發(fā)語言介紹

華為手機的APP開發(fā)語言及設(shè)置指南

iOS平臺主要采用Objective-C語言進行應(yīng)用開發(fā)。開發(fā)者通常會使用蘋果公司提供的iOS SDK來搭建開發(fā)環(huán)境。這個SDK提供了從創(chuàng)建程序到調(diào)試、運行和測試等一系列開發(fā)過程中所需的工具。對于安卓開發(fā),主要使用Java語言,開發(fā)者會借助谷歌的Android SDK進行開發(fā)。對于微軟Windows phone 7,開發(fā)語言是C。塞班symbian系統(tǒng)版本的開發(fā)語言則是C++。針對不同的手機系統(tǒng),各系統(tǒng)開發(fā)公司提供了相應(yīng)的開發(fā)工具,通過學(xué)習(xí)相應(yīng)SDK的開發(fā)文檔,開發(fā)者可以輕松進行各種APP的開發(fā)。

三、主流手機應(yīng)用軟件開發(fā)平臺概述

當前主流的手機APP系統(tǒng)包括安卓、蘋果和鴻蒙。每個系統(tǒng)都有自己對應(yīng)的軟件開發(fā)平臺。對于安卓開發(fā),Android Studio和Eclipse是開發(fā)人員常用的工具。Android Studio作為安卓的官方IDE,為開發(fā)者提供了全面的開發(fā)環(huán)境和工具,是安卓app開發(fā)的強大平臺。

四、手機應(yīng)用軟件開發(fā)的基本流程

手機應(yīng)用軟件開發(fā)通常包括需求分析、設(shè)計、編碼、測試、發(fā)布等階段。開發(fā)者首先通過需求分析明確應(yīng)用的功能和目標用戶,然后進行界面設(shè)計和功能設(shè)計。接下來是編碼階段,開發(fā)者會根據(jù)目標系統(tǒng)選擇相應(yīng)的開發(fā)語言和工具進行編碼。完成后進行測試,確保應(yīng)用的功能和性能達到預(yù)期。最后發(fā)布應(yīng)用到相應(yīng)的應(yīng)用商店供用戶下載和使用。

華為手機的APP開發(fā)語言及設(shè)置指南

五、手機應(yīng)用軟件開發(fā)的前景與挑戰(zhàn)

隨著智能手機的普及和移動互聯(lián)網(wǎng)的發(fā)展,手機應(yīng)用軟件開發(fā)前景廣闊。開發(fā)者也面臨著一些挑戰(zhàn),如市場競爭激烈、用戶需求多樣化、技術(shù)更新快速等。為了應(yīng)對這些挑戰(zhàn),開發(fā)者需要不斷學(xué)習(xí)新技術(shù)和市場需求,提供有競爭力的應(yīng)用產(chǎn)品和服務(wù)。隨著鴻蒙系統(tǒng)的崛起,針對該系統(tǒng)的應(yīng)用開發(fā)也將成為未來的熱點和趨勢,為開發(fā)者帶來全新的挑戰(zhàn)和機遇。Java開發(fā)及相關(guān)工具介紹

一、Eclipse:Java開發(fā)利器

Eclipse是一款廣泛應(yīng)用于軟件開發(fā)領(lǐng)域的工具,特別是在Java開發(fā)中占據(jù)重要地位。它支持跨平臺開發(fā),并配備了豐富的插件庫。其中,Java開發(fā)工具(Java Development Kit,JDK)作為標準的插件集之一,為開發(fā)者提供了強大的支持。與其他固定的IDE相比,Eclipse具有更高的靈活性和自主性。它為開發(fā)者提供了一個集成化的工作環(huán)境,簡化了開發(fā)流程。

二、蘋果開發(fā)平臺:Xcode的魅力

華為手機的APP開發(fā)語言及設(shè)置指南

對于iOS開發(fā)平臺,Xcode無疑是核心工具。這款運行在MacOS系統(tǒng)上的IDE由蘋果公司精心打造。Xcode為開發(fā)者提供了統(tǒng)一的用戶界面設(shè)計,使得編碼、測試、調(diào)試等流程在一個簡潔的窗口內(nèi)完成。它的出現(xiàn),極大地提高了OSX和iOS應(yīng)用程序的開發(fā)效率。

三、鴻蒙開發(fā)平臺:華為devecostudio的探索

鴻蒙開發(fā)工具devecostudio是華為自主研發(fā)的鴻蒙操作系統(tǒng)的終端開發(fā)工具,現(xiàn)已面向全球用戶開放使用。作為鴻蒙系統(tǒng)的專屬開發(fā)平臺,devecostudio支持多種軟件開發(fā)語言,具備程序開發(fā)、軟件調(diào)試、維護檢驗等功能。其舒適的開發(fā)環(huán)境、智能化的可視化編程特點,能實時呈現(xiàn)編程效果,大大降低了開發(fā)難度。

四、免編程的app開發(fā)工具:apppark(布雷澤科技)

apppark(布雷澤科技)是一款無需編程基礎(chǔ)的可視化軟件開發(fā)工具,同步支持android、iOS以及harmony系統(tǒng)。平臺集成了常見的app功能模塊,用戶只需通過簡單的拖拽操作,替換相關(guān)的圖文信息和配置參數(shù),即可快速完成app的開發(fā)與上線。這一工具極大地節(jié)省了手機應(yīng)用軟件開發(fā)公司的成本,實現(xiàn)了低成本高效率的軟件開發(fā)。

華為手機的APP開發(fā)語言及設(shè)置指南

布雷澤科技專注于用戶體驗設(shè)計與程序設(shè)計,主營業(yè)務(wù)包括高端網(wǎng)絡(luò)定制、軟件定制開發(fā)、高端APP定制、UI設(shè)計、網(wǎng)頁定制以及小程序定制開發(fā)等。其核心技術(shù)團隊擁有豐富經(jīng)驗,在APP、小程序、網(wǎng)站建設(shè)等架構(gòu)系統(tǒng)開發(fā)上擁有獨特見解和卓越能力??头?lián)系電話:136-6221-0596/0755-86522920。


本文原地址:http://m.czyjwy.com/news/103552.html
本站文章均來自互聯(lián)網(wǎng),僅供學(xué)習(xí)參考,如有侵犯您的版權(quán),請郵箱聯(lián)系我們刪除!
上一篇:華為手機的APP開發(fā)指南:解鎖開發(fā)者模式,輕松開發(fā)應(yīng)用!
下一篇:華為手機的APP開發(fā)揭秘:如何打造創(chuàng)新軟件應(yīng)用?